The Benefits of an Ethanol Fireplace

Ethanol fireplaces are a fantastic alternative to wood or gas fires, since they don't require a chimney or flue. They don't produce smoke, ash, or mess and can easily be moved from one home to another.

Cost

The cost of a fireplace constructed of bioethanol is contingent on the style and type you choose. There are models ranging priced from a few hundred bucks to a few thousand dollars however, they are generally less expensive than wood or gas fireplace. Some are designed to be freestanding while others can be recessed into the wall or attached to a chimney. Ethanol fires are also more ecologically green than wood-burning fires.

Bio ethanol fires are very popular because they offer a beautiful, natural flame without any smoke or soot. They are suitable for almost any room, and they are easy to maintain. You should only use bio-ethanol fuels that are specifically designed for fireplaces like these. Other types may damage the burner and increase the risk of fire. Additionally, you should not keep flammable items near the bio ethanol fire.

Ethanol fireplaces are excellent for heating rooms, but they shouldn't be relied on as your primary source of heat. They are more efficient than wood-burning fire places and can generate lots of heat, about 2kW on average. This is not enough to heat an entire home, but it will certainly help in warming an area.

You should also consider the cost of maintaining an ethanol fireplace. The fireplace must be stored in a secure location and out of reach of pets and children. Follow the manufacturer's instructions when adding fuel, putting out the flame and allowing the heater to cool.

Environmental impact

A fireplace inserts that is ethanol-powered is an environmentally friendly alternative to traditional fireplaces that burn wood. Bioethanol fuel is produced by utilizing waste plant materials like straw, maize, and corn. The liquid biofuel is then further distilled to allow it to burn efficiently and effectively. This kind of fuel is thought to be renewable energy source that leaves no unpleasant odours or harmful emissions. It is free of soot and smoke, making it a safer choice for your home than other types of fires.

They can be installed in any room of your home because they do not require venting or chimneys. They are easy to operate, and most models have at least one remote control. A majority of them also have an inbuilt cooling system that prevents the fuel from overheating. They can be used either as a primary source of heat or as an additional heating system. They can also be a good option for those living in apartments or condos.

Bioethanol fireplaces electric produce very low levels of smells. They are therefore an ideal option for homes with people who suffer from allergies or asthma. This type of fireplace is safe to use in a nursery or child's room. It is important to keep in mind that these fireplaces must be kept a safe distance from any flammable items, such as furniture and curtains.

One of the greatest benefits of an ethanol fireplace is its ease of use. It is simpler to install than a fireplace that burns wood and doesn't require complicated wiring or installation. The fuel in liquid form can be stored in a portable container to allow it to be easily moved from one room to another. This lets you enjoy a fireplace's warmth without having to deal with the mess of cutting the wood, putting it in a stack and cleaning the wood.

Another advantage of a bioethanol fireplace is that it creates very little carbon dioxide, making it an excellent alternative for those who are concerned about the environment. Additionally, these fireplaces are a great way to save energy and money.

Safety

A bioethanol fireplace can be a safer alternative to an open flame. They are easy to operate, produce less smoke and burn cleaner than other alternatives. However, as with all fireplaces and other fire-producing appliances they can be dangerous if used incorrectly. These fireplaces require special attention and attention, so be sure to adhere to the guidelines.

If you're using a fireplace made of bioethanol, be sure to place it in a space that is well ventilated and away from any other materials that can ignite. Keep pets and children away from the fire. Don't try to move it while it's burning, as this could result in an accident.

Bio ethanol fireplaces aren't as hazardous as wood or gas fireplaces, however there are some safety guidelines that must be followed to ensure a safe operation. For instance, keep flammable objects at least 1500mm away from the flame and not touching it while the flame is burning. It's also important to never add fuel to a fire that isn't approved.

The burning process of a bio-ethanol fireplace is very secure, particularly when you follow the directions. The fuel is pumped through the vapour-accelerator, which evaporates and is then ignited by filament. This method of combustion makes sure that the fuel is completely burned and eliminates unpleasant odours as well as harmful substances such as dioxins and furans.

It is important to adhere to the guidelines given by the manufacturer when installing or operating an ethanol fireplace. Additionally, they should be kept clear from combustible materials such as curtains and newspapers. They should also be kept at a safe distance from other appliances in the home and not be used near sleeping children or animals.

The primary benefit of a bioethanol fireplace is that it doesn't emit any harmful fumes or odours and is a much safer option for households with small pets or children. They're also more convenient than traditional fireplaces since they don't require a chimney and don't cause carbon monoxide poisoning. These fireplaces offer a variety of advantages, such as the ability to put them wherever you want and move them around.

Installation

A bioethanol fireplace can add warmth and ambiance to any room. They are available in a variety of styles and can be installed in different ways. They can be wall-mounted, freestanding, built-in or see-through. You must always read the installation manual for a fireplace before installing it. This will help you avoid any issues during installation and ensure that your fireplace is safe to use.

The procedure of installing bioethanol fireplaces is quite easy. It involves building frames within the wall to house the fireplace and fitting the burner into it. The frame should be made of an unflammable material. This will prevent the flame from igniting your wall. It also stops the flame from spreading to other areas of the room. The frame must be secured to the wall using suitable screws and dowels.

In contrast to other types of fireplaces, ethanol fires (crouch-kvist.blogbright.net) don't require a chimney or a flue. This makes them a more cost-effective option for homeowners. Additionally they can be utilized in any room in the house and are easily moved from one location to another. Furthermore, they don't generate any harmful emissions.

If used properly When used correctly, bioethanol fireplaces are safe. Like any fire it is essential to keep them away from children and any flammable surfaces. Additionally the fuel should be stored in a secure location and the fire extinguished before refueling it.

Ethanol fireplaces do not produce soot or ash, and they are easy to clean. They are a great alternative for those who are worried about the impact on the environment that traditional wood fireplaces-burning fireplaces. Ethanol-fueled fireplaces are a great alternative to electric or gas fireplaces.

While bioethanol fireplaces are great additions to any home, they should not be used as a primary source of heat. They are designed to add warmth and create a cozy environment however, they are not strong enough for heating an entire house. Employing a professional to set up your bioethanol fireplace is the best option.
